Weather today: Light to moderate rainfall likely in most parts of the country

Published On: June 12, 2022 10:21 AM NPT By: Republica

KATHMANDU, June 12: Most parts of the country will experience partial to moderate cloud cover with light to moderate rain in some places. According to the Department of Hydrology and Meteorology (DHM), there is a general effect of monsoon winds in Province 1, Madhesh, Bagmati and Gandaki provinces and local winds in other provinces.

Consumer price inflation hit 7.87 percent during mid-April and mid-May, more than double of last year’s

Published On: June 11, 2022 07:20 PM NPT By: Republica

KATHMANDU, June 11: The consumer price inflation during the one-month period from mid-April to mid-May hit 7.87 percent, more than double of 3.65 percent of the same period of the last fiscal year.
